#51a35e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#51a35e is composed of 31.8% red, 63.9%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 129.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 47.8%. #51a35e color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ffbc with #004700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#51a35e color description : Dark moderate lime green.

#51a35e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#51a35e has RGB values of R:81, G:163,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5350238.

Shades and Tints of #51a35e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030603 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#51a35e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777d78 is the less saturated color, while #06ee2b is the most saturated one.
